Yesterday, Thursday, July 25th, we had the honor of hosting the inauguration of the installation ‘Biomaterials AR Chandelier’ (2024) by British artist Anna Dumitriu at the Russiz Superiore Winery.
The work explores how biomaterials and augmented reality art can influence sustainability and the circular economy in the wine industry.
The installation, inspired by the shapes of nature and the winery at Russiz Superiore, recreates a chandelier using biomaterials derived from wine waste, and activates a generative augmented reality app, #artandwineAR, offering each user a unique experience. It is also accompanied by sonification of fermentation data produced by IoT corks in the barrels of the Marco Felluga winery.
The project was carried out in collaboration with the EU STARTS Better Factory: Internet of Art and Wine (IoWA) Project and the Serbian tech company BUBAMARA-V.
